    Traditional IVF Clinics: The Standard Protocol

    Traditional IVF clinics use the standard protocol, which involves ovarian stimulation, egg retrieval, fertilization, and embryo transfer. This approach has been in use since the first IVF baby was born in 1978 and has proven to be successful for many couples. However, the standard protocol is not without its drawbacks.

    One of the main criticisms of traditional IVF clinics is the use of high doses of hormones to stimulate the ovaries and produce multiple eggs. These hormones can cause uncomfortable side effects, such as bloating, mood swings, and headaches. Moreover, the use of high doses of hormones can also increase the risk of ovarian hyperstimulation syndrome (OHSS), a potentially serious condition that can lead to bloating, abdominal pain, and fluid accumulation in the abdomen and chest.

    Another concern with traditional IVF clinics is the lack of individualized treatment plans. The standard protocol is the same for all patients, regardless of their unique needs and circumstances. This one-size-fits-all approach may not be the most effective for some patients, leading to lower success rates.

    Advanced IVF Clinics: Cutting-edge Technology and Techniques

    On the other hand, advanced IVF clinics utilize the latest technology and techniques to improve success rates and minimize side effects. One of the most significant advancements in IVF is the use of mild ovarian stimulation. This approach involves using lower doses of hormones to stimulate the ovaries, resulting in fewer side effects and a lower risk of OHSS.

    Another innovation in IVF is the use of time-lapse embryo monitoring. This technology allows embryologists to continuously monitor the development of embryos without disturbing them. This results in a more natural environment for the embryos, leading to better outcomes.

    Advanced IVF clinics also offer more personalized treatment plans for each patient. They take into account factors such as age, ovarian reserve, and previous fertility history to create a customized protocol that is tailored to each individual’s needs. This individualized approach has been shown to improve success rates and give patients a better chance of achieving a successful pregnancy.

    Natural Cycle IVF: A More Natural Alternative

    In addition to mild stimulation and time-lapse embryo monitoring, advanced IVF clinics also offer a more natural approach to fertility treatment known as natural cycle IVF. This alternative to traditional IVF involves monitoring the natural cycle of the woman’s body and retrieving the one egg that is naturally produced each month. The egg is then fertilized in the laboratory and transferred into the uterus, eliminating the need for hormone stimulation altogether.

    Natural cycle IVF has gained popularity in recent years due to its more natural and less invasive approach. It does not involve the use of hormones, which means there are no side effects or risks of OHSS. This approach is also more cost-effective since it does not require expensive hormone medications.

    What is At-Home Insemination with a Syringe?

    At-home insemination is the process of placing sperm into the vagina, near the cervix, in hopes of fertilizing an egg. This can be done through natural intercourse or with the use of a syringe. The syringe method involves collecting the semen from a donor or partner and using a syringe to insert it into the vagina. This method is commonly used by same-sex female couples or individuals trying to conceive on their own.

    The Process of At-Home Insemination

    The first step in at-home insemination is selecting a sperm donor. This can be done through a sperm bank or by finding a known donor. It is important to thoroughly research and consider the health and genetic history of the donor before making a decision.

    Once a donor is selected, the next step is to purchase a sterile syringe from a pharmacy. The syringe should be a 5-10ml size with a rounded tip, making it easier to insert into the vagina.

    Adorable baby in a paw-print onesie, smiling widely with bright blue eyes, lying on a soft surface.

    At-Home Insemination with a Syringe: A Natural and Empowering Approach

    Next, the semen sample should be collected and placed into a sterile container. It is essential to follow proper hygiene practices to avoid any contamination. The sample should then be drawn into the syringe and used immediately.

    The best time to perform at-home insemination is during ovulation, which can be tracked through ovulation predictor kits or by monitoring basal body temperature. The semen should be inserted into the vagina near the cervix, using the syringe.

    Tips for Success

    While at-home insemination with a syringe can be an effective method of conception, there are a few tips that can increase the chances of success:

    1. Timing is crucial – make sure to inseminate during ovulation for the best chance of fertilization.

    2. Elevate the hips – after insemination, elevate the hips for 15-20 minutes to allow the sperm to travel towards the cervix.

    3. Stay relaxed – stress can impact fertility, so it is important to stay relaxed during the process.

    4. Consider using a fertility-friendly lubricant – regular lubricants can interfere with sperm motility, so using a fertility-friendly option can increase chances of success.

    5. Be patient – it may take a few tries before conception occurs, so it is essential to be patient and stay positive.

    What is Intra Cervical Insemination?

    Intra Cervical Insemination (ICI) is a form of artificial insemination that involves placing washed and prepared sperm into the cervix. It is a relatively simple and non-invasive procedure that can be performed at a fertility clinic or at home with the help of a fertility specialist. The sperm is usually collected through masturbation or by using a special collection condom during intercourse. The collected sperm is then washed and prepared to remove any impurities and increase its viability before being inserted into the cervix.

    How Does Intra Cervical Insemination Work?

    During ovulation, the cervix produces a thin mucus that helps the sperm to travel through the vagina and into the uterus. In ICI, the prepared sperm is inserted into the cervix using a thin catheter, bypassing the vagina and increasing the chances of fertilization. This procedure can be performed at home with the help of a fertility specialist or at a fertility clinic. It is usually recommended to be done around the time of ovulation to increase the chances of conception.
